Elder financial abuse is as devastating as physical abuse, and it's a problem on the rise. In this episode, Elizabeth Loewy and Kieran Beer explore both simple and high-tech ways to pick up on the signs that vulnerable adults might be being defrauded. With an estimated 70-80% of all US assets now held by seniors (the Baby Boomers are aging!), financial institutions have to be prepared to spot and respond quickly to elder abuse scams. If you're a compliance officer, do you know what to look for, and what to do if you think there's a problem? Elizabeth Loewy has spent three decades fighting elder abuse, first as a Prosecutor (she served as co-counsel in the trial involving the financial exploitation of well-known philanthropist Brooke Astor by her son and his attorney, which resulted in convictions to both defendants), and now as co-founder and COO of FinTech company EverSafe.
